Budhpur - Manteswar, Purba Bardhaman

Budhpur is a village situated in the Manteswar subdivision of Purba Bardhaman district, West Bengal. It is located approximately 9.8 km from Manteswar. Shushunia serves as the Gram Panchayat for Budhpur village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Budhpur is 319646. The village covers a total geographical area of 96.04 hectares and falls under the 713515 pincode. Barddhaman is the nearest town, located about 47 km away.

Budhpur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Monteswar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Bardhaman - Durgapur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Budhpur

As per Census 2011, Budhpur village has a total population of 690 people, consisting of 350 males and 340 females. The village has 161 households and a sex ratio of 971 females per 1,000 males. There are 43 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 638 literate and 52 illiterate residents.

Transport and Connectivity of Budhpur

Budhpur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ared van services. The nearest railway station is Balgona, while the nearest airport is Kazi Nazrul Islam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 72.0 km.
